Seborrhea

Hi I was diagnosed with Seborrheic Dermatitis on my face about a week ago... I've been using a Cetaphil cleanser and the new Promiseb cream to treat it.  I was wondering if I should also be using a moisturizer for my skin.  I don't know much about fungal infections but I heard they can feed on moisturizers which only making the symptoms worse.  

So if anyone can help can you tell me if using a moisturizer would help?  And if so what moisturizer do you recommend for SD?

Hello,
Promiseb cream that you are using is very effective for seborrheic dermatitis. Apart from the promise cream, you can use a gentle non perfumed, hypoallergenic moisturizer and steroid creams. Using humidifiers in the house also helps. I hope it helps. Take care and please do keep me posted on how you are doing or in case you have any additional doubts.
